Transaction bbaaa384afe72011e8a70d5d679f184e987429bd6699efe13acfc96e17b83813
1 Input
1 Output
-
bbaaa384afe72011e8a70d5d679f184e987429bd6699efe13acfc96e17b83813:0
- value
- 21000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 68f6d492251653388191efc851636c199ea6811d4f2acb77391307c2d7150d82
- address
- bc1pdrmdfy39zefn3qv3aly9zcmvrx02dqgafu4vkaeezvru94c4pkpq4cuj58